What is Density? Density – the amount of matter that will fit into a given amount of space. - Density = mass/volume. - Density is measured in grams/cubic centimeter (g/cm3) or grams/millimeter (g/mL).

Guiding question

How can density be used to identify a substance? Substances have a specific, unchanging density. You can calculate the density of a substance and then compare it to the known density of various substances.

Guiding question Imagine you went to a planet where the gravity was different from Earth’s. Which would change: your mass or your weight? Explain.

Your weight would change, because weight is a measure of the pull of gravity on the mass of a substance. Mass does not depend on the location of the object.

What is Volume? Volume is the amount of space that a substance or object occupies *Volume = Length x Width x Height (for regularly shaped objects). Using water displacement, determine the volume of an irregularity shaped object.

Using a graduated cylinder, determine the volume of liquid Liquid volume is measured milliliters (mL) Solids volume is measured in cubic centimeters (cm3)1 milliliter(mL) is equal to 1 cm3

Measuring the volume of an irregular solid using Water Displacement Method

A B

Step 1: Add water to a graduated cylinder and record the amount.

Step 2: Place the object into the graduated cylinder.

Step 3: Record the volume of the water with the object.Step 4: Find the difference in water volume by subtracting.

Step 5: Convert the liquid volumemeasurement (mL) to the measurement for solid volume (cm3).*** Remember: 1 mL = 1 cm3

Units Mass is grams (g) Volume is cubic centimeters written as cm3 Density is written as g/cm3 (regular object) Density is often expressed as grams per milliliter, or g/mL (irregular objects)
